2 <br /> BOCC: Approval of Final Design, Summer-Fall, 2017 <br /> Guaranteed Maximum Price <br /> Permitting, State Review, Fall 2017— Summer 2019 <br /> Construction Period (16-20 months) <br /> Occupation Fall-Winter, 2019 <br /> 1 <br /> 2 Concurrent to this process, staff was requested to provide information to the Board regarding a <br /> 3 potential scope expansion of the project to include the co-location of a Law Enforcement <br /> 4 Center/Sheriff's Offices ("LEC") with the proposed Detention Center. Staff proposes that this <br /> 5 scope discussion include three options: <br /> 6 1) Standalone Detention Center only — This option represents the current project scope <br /> 7 as contained in the County's Capital Investment Plan (CIP). <br /> 8 2) Detention Center with co-located LEC — This option would construct new <br /> 9 administrative office space on the Detention Center site and relocate the Sheriff's <br /> 10 administrative offices from the courthouse to the Detention Center. <br /> 11 3) Detention Center with infrastructure for future co-located LEC — This option would <br /> 12 prepare the Detention Center site and install appropriate utilities and infrastructure for a <br /> 13 colocation of the Sheriff's administrative offices on the Detention Center site at some <br /> 14 point in the future. <br /> 15 <br /> 16 If the Board of Commissioners authorizes further analysis of these options, staff recommends <br /> 17 five evaluation criteria to inform the decision making process. These factors include: <br /> 18 1) Cost of Construction <br /> 19 2) Staffing (Detention and LEC) <br /> 20 3) Operations and Maintenance (Detention and LEC) <br /> 21 4) Court operations support and security <br /> 22 5) "Backfill" options for potentially vacated spaces within the Justice Facility <br /> 23 <br /> 24 A matrix of general information regarding the three development options as well as comparative <br /> 25 topics to be addressed in the Designer's analysis for each of the five decision factors is <br /> 26 attached.
